How to Make Chrome Your Default Web Browser in Windows 10

Make Chrome Your Default Browser in Windows 10

Default apps > Web browser

Symptom:
1. Make Chrome your default browser option when launching Chrome doesn't work anymore for Windows 10.
2. Even you click OK, Microsoft Edge will still be the default browser.

Solution:
1. Click Windows Start button on bottom left of screen.
2. Click "Settings".
3. Click "System, Display, notifications, apps, power".
4. Click "Default apps".
5. Click "Web browser".
6. In Choose an app, select your desired web browser.

This works fine for FireFox and other web browsers too.

Facebook Videos Green Picture in Chrome

All Facebook Videos Showing Green Picture in Chrome

Green picture Facebook video

Symptom:
1. After upgrading to Windows 10, all Facebook videos are showing green picture.
2. There's audio playing in the background, but just no picture being displayed.

Resolution:
1. This steps only work for Chrome browser.
2. Enter "chrome://flags/" in Address box.
3. Scroll down to "Disable hardware-accelerated video decode". You can use CTRL + F (Find option) and enter keyword "hardware" to jump there quicker.
4. Click "Disable".
5. A new pop up button "Relaunch Now" appears on bottom of screen, click on that.
6. Chrome browser will restart.
7. Try playing the Facebook video now, it should work fine.

How to Disable Flash Hardware Acceleration on Google Chrome

Unable to Disable Flash Hardware Acceleration on Google Chrome

Unable to click anything in flash settings

Use chrome://flags/ as workaround

Symptom: 
1. When you right click on any flash video to get settings menu up, the checkbox for hardware acceleration and any other flash menu tab cannot be clicked.
2. You have already tried my steps to disable Flash Hardware Acceleration at HERE but it still doesn't work.

Solution:
1. Open a new tab in Google Chrome.
2. Type in "chrome://flags/" on the URL address box.
3. Scroll down and look for "Disable hardware-accelerated video decode".
4. Click once to "Disable".
5. Click "Relaunch Now".
6. Once you've relaunched Google Chrome, all flash videos will start playing normally again.

Note:
I've previously disabled flash hardware acceleration on Google Chrome by right clicking flash settings. But somehow after Windows update and resetting Google Chrome browser, the flash checkbox menu no longer is clickable. This is the workaround that I could find to play all my flash videos normally once again on Google Chrome.
